An unexpected one-pot synthetic approach toward spiro[fluorene-9,9‘-xanthene] (<b>SFX</b>) under excessive MeSO<sub>3</sub>H conditions has been developed.
The key step involves a thermodynamically controlled cyclization reaction. Blue-light-emitting materials based on <b>SFX</b> building blocks that
exhibit high thermal stability have also been synthesized.
